Designs Unveiled for Warsaw Art Museum and Theatre

The buildings will sit next to each other, connected with landscaping that will bring in over 100 new trees. Renderings by Encore courtesy Thomas Phifer and Partners

Thomas Phifer and Partners has released its design for what ArchDaily reports will be the largest cultural project in Poland’s recent history.

The designs are for a 161,458-sf museum and 107,639-sf theater, built next to each other and connected with landscaping that will bring in over 100 new trees.

To emphasize the buildings’ role in the public sphere, the museum will be accessible from all sides, featuring an open lobby and auditorium space to hold public functions.

Two permanent installations have been announced for the museum: The Zofia Kulik archive and the reconstruction of the Polish radio experimental studio.

Adjacent to the museum, the theater will sit on a nearby square “with a cast metal façade that is perforated with large portals,” ArchDaily reports.

At night, stage lights will radiate outward, “transforming the theater into a beacon,” the architects say.

Multipurpose sports facility will be first completed building at Obama Presidential Center

When it opens in late 2025, the Home Court will be the first completed space on the Obama Presidential Center campus in Chicago. Located on the southwest corner of the 19.3-acre Obama Presidential Center in Jackson Park, the Home Court will be the largest gathering space on the campus. Renderings recently have been released of the 45,000-sf multipurpose sports facility and events space designed by Moody Nolan.

Nebraska’s Joslyn Art Museum to reopen this summer with new Snøhetta-designed pavilion

In Omaha, Neb., the Joslyn Art Museum, which displays art from ancient times to the present, has announced it will reopen on September 10, following the completion of its new 42,000-sf Rhonda & Howard Hawks Pavilion. Designed in collaboration with Snøhetta and Alley Poyner Macchietto Architecture, the Hawks Pavilion is part of a museum overhaul that will expand the gallery space by more than 40%.
